navman1gps.com machine learning Unleashing the Power of Machine Learning in Artificial Intelligence: A Path to Intelligent Innovation

Unleashing the Power of Machine Learning in Artificial Intelligence: A Path to Intelligent Innovation


machine learning artificial intelligence

Understanding Machine Learning in Artificial Intelligence

Machine learning is a pivotal component of artificial intelligence (AI), driving advancements across various industries by enabling systems to learn from data and improve over time. This article explores the fundamentals of machine learning, its role in AI, and its impact on the modern world.

What is Machine Learning?

Machine learning is a subset of AI that focuses on developing algorithms and statistical models that allow computers to perform tasks without explicit instructions. Instead, these systems use patterns and inference to make decisions or predictions based on data inputs.

How Does Machine Learning Work?

The process typically involves several stages:

  • Data Collection: Gathering relevant data that will be used for training the machine learning model.
  • Data Preparation: Cleaning and organizing the data to ensure accuracy and consistency.
  • Model Training: Using algorithms to identify patterns within the data. This phase involves adjusting parameters until the model accurately predicts outcomes.
  • Evaluation: Testing the model’s performance using a separate dataset to ensure it generalizes well to new, unseen data.
  • Deployment: Integrating the trained model into real-world applications where it can provide insights or automate tasks.

The Role of Machine Learning in AI

Machine learning enhances AI by providing systems with the ability to automatically improve through experience. This capability is crucial for developing intelligent applications such as speech recognition, image analysis, autonomous vehicles, and personalized recommendations. By leveraging vast amounts of data, machine learning models can uncover intricate patterns that enable more accurate predictions and smarter decision-making processes.

Applications of Machine Learning

The influence of machine learning spans numerous sectors, including:

  • Healthcare: Assisting in disease diagnosis through image analysis and predicting patient outcomes based on historical data.
  • Finance: Detecting fraudulent transactions and managing risk through predictive analytics.
  • E-commerce: Personalizing shopping experiences by recommending products based on user behavior.
  • Agriculture: Optimizing crop yields through predictive modeling of weather patterns and soil conditions.

The Future of Machine Learning

The future holds immense potential for machine learning as computational power increases and more sophisticated algorithms are developed. Emerging trends include reinforcement learning, which enables systems to learn complex behaviors through trial and error, and unsupervised learning techniques that allow for deeper insights into unstructured data without labeled examples.

The continued evolution of machine learning promises transformative changes across industries, driving innovation and enhancing everyday life with smarter technologies. As researchers push boundaries further, society stands on the brink of even greater advancements powered by this dynamic field within artificial intelligence.

Conclusion

The integration of machine learning into artificial intelligence has revolutionized how machines understand and interact with the world. Its ability to adapt and improve autonomously makes it an indispensable tool for solving complex problems across various domains. As technology progresses, machine learning will undoubtedly play a central role in shaping an intelligent future.

 

9 Essential Tips for Mastering Machine Learning and AI

  1. Understand the problem you are trying to solve before choosing a machine learning algorithm.
  2. Preprocess and clean your data to ensure high-quality input for your model.
  3. Split your data into training and testing sets to evaluate the performance of your model accurately.
  4. Choose the appropriate evaluation metrics based on the nature of your problem (e.g., accuracy, precision, recall).
  5. Experiment with different algorithms and hyperparameters to find the best model for your data.
  6. Regularly update and retrain your models as new data becomes available to maintain their accuracy.
  7. Consider the ethical implications of using AI/ML systems and ensure fairness and transparency in decision-making processes.
  8. Stay updated with the latest advancements in machine learning research and techniques to improve your models continuously.
  9. Collaborate with domain experts to gain insights into specific industries or fields where AI/ML can be applied effectively.

Understand the problem you are trying to solve before choosing a machine learning algorithm.

Before selecting a machine learning algorithm, it is crucial to have a deep understanding of the problem you aim to solve. By comprehensively grasping the intricacies and requirements of the task at hand, you can effectively narrow down your choices and identify the most suitable algorithm for the job. This initial step not only ensures that your approach aligns with the specific needs of the problem but also maximizes the potential for successful outcomes by laying a solid foundation for the application of machine learning techniques.

Preprocess and clean your data to ensure high-quality input for your model.

Preprocessing and cleaning your data is a crucial step in machine learning that significantly impacts the performance and accuracy of your model. High-quality input data leads to more reliable and meaningful outcomes, as it reduces noise and inconsistencies that can skew results. This process involves handling missing values, removing duplicates, normalizing or standardizing features, and encoding categorical variables. By ensuring that the data fed into the model is clean and well-prepared, you enable the algorithms to learn effectively from patterns without being misled by irrelevant or erroneous information. Ultimately, thorough data preprocessing lays a solid foundation for building robust machine learning models that deliver accurate predictions and insights.

Split your data into training and testing sets to evaluate the performance of your model accurately.

When developing a machine learning model, it’s essential to split your data into training and testing sets to accurately evaluate its performance. The training set is used to teach the model by allowing it to learn patterns and relationships within the data. Once the model is trained, the testing set, which consists of unseen data, is used to assess how well the model generalizes to new information. This separation helps prevent overfitting, where a model performs well on training data but poorly on new data. By evaluating the model with a distinct testing set, developers can gain insights into its accuracy and reliability in real-world applications, ensuring that it meets desired performance standards before deployment.

Choose the appropriate evaluation metrics based on the nature of your problem (e.g., accuracy, precision, recall).

When working with machine learning and artificial intelligence models, selecting the right evaluation metrics is crucial for assessing performance effectively. It is essential to choose metrics that align with the specific characteristics of your problem to gain meaningful insights into model accuracy and effectiveness. For instance, depending on the nature of the task, metrics such as accuracy, precision, and recall can provide valuable information on how well the model is performing in terms of correctly identifying patterns or making predictions. By carefully considering and utilizing appropriate evaluation metrics, you can enhance the reliability and efficiency of your machine learning solutions.

Experiment with different algorithms and hyperparameters to find the best model for your data.

To optimize the performance of your machine learning model in artificial intelligence, it is essential to experiment with various algorithms and hyperparameters. By exploring different combinations, you can identify the most suitable model for your specific dataset. Testing multiple options allows you to fine-tune the model’s parameters and improve its accuracy and efficiency in making predictions or decisions. This iterative process of experimentation plays a crucial role in achieving optimal results and harnessing the full potential of machine learning technology.

Regularly update and retrain your models as new data becomes available to maintain their accuracy.

To ensure the continued accuracy and effectiveness of your machine learning models in artificial intelligence, it is essential to regularly update and retrain them as new data becomes available. By incorporating fresh data into the training process, you enable your models to adapt to evolving patterns and trends, ultimately enhancing their predictive capabilities. This proactive approach not only helps maintain the relevance of your models but also ensures that they remain reliable and reflective of real-world conditions over time.

Consider the ethical implications of using AI/ML systems and ensure fairness and transparency in decision-making processes.

When implementing AI and machine learning systems, it is crucial to consider the ethical implications to ensure that these technologies are used responsibly. This involves actively promoting fairness and transparency in decision-making processes to prevent biases that could lead to unfair treatment or discrimination. Developers and organizations must strive to create algorithms that are inclusive and representative of diverse populations, while also being transparent about how decisions are made. By doing so, they can build trust with users and stakeholders, demonstrating a commitment to ethical standards and accountability in the deployment of AI/ML systems. This approach not only enhances the credibility of AI applications but also ensures that they contribute positively to society.

Stay updated with the latest advancements in machine learning research and techniques to improve your models continuously.

Staying abreast of the latest advancements in machine learning research and techniques is crucial for enhancing the performance of your models. By staying updated, you can incorporate cutting-edge methodologies and best practices into your workflow, ensuring that your models remain competitive and effective. Continuous learning and adaptation to new trends in the field of machine learning enable you to push the boundaries of what is achievable and deliver optimal results in various applications.

Collaborate with domain experts to gain insights into specific industries or fields where AI/ML can be applied effectively.

Collaborating with domain experts is crucial for successfully applying machine learning and artificial intelligence in specific industries or fields. These experts possess deep knowledge and understanding of the nuances, challenges, and opportunities within their domains, which can significantly enhance the development of AI/ML solutions. By working closely with them, data scientists and engineers can gain valuable insights into industry-specific data patterns, regulatory considerations, and practical applications. This collaboration ensures that AI/ML models are not only technically sound but also relevant and effective in addressing real-world problems. Moreover, domain experts can help identify key performance indicators and success metrics that align with industry standards, ultimately leading to more impactful and sustainable AI implementations.

Leave a Reply

Your email address will not be published. Required fields are marked *

Time limit exceeded. Please complete the captcha once again.